Live Betting Strategy Explained

Imagine placing a wager as the action unfolds. This is in-play wagering, a dynamic form of gambling that happens during a sporting event.

Unlike traditional pre-match options, this method allows you to react to every play. The odds shift constantly based on what’s happening in the game.

This real-time way to engage became possible through technology. Since the 1990s, advances have let bookmakers update prices instantly.

What started with phone calls is now on sophisticated online platforms. These sites offer instant opportunities across many sports.

The legal landscape changed in 2018. The U.S. Supreme Court struck down a federal ban, paving the way for state-by-state regulation.

Today, sports betting is legal in 38 states and Washington, D.C. Rules for in-play action still vary by location.

Understanding Live Betting Fundamentals

The roots of wagering on athletic contests stretch back millennia. For most of history, placing a gamble was strictly a pre-event activity.

History and Evolution of Live Betting

Bookmakers could not adjust odds fast enough to match game action. The 1990s brought a major shift with telephone-based wagering.

This was the first real form of in-play action. It laid the groundwork for today’s digital platforms.

Era Method Key Limitation
Ancient to 20th Century Pre-match wagers Static odds, no in-game updates
1990s Telephone betting Slow communication, limited access
Modern Day Online & mobile apps Requires constant data connection

Real-Time Odds and Technological Advancements

Internet connectivity changed everything. Sophisticated algorithms now update prices instantly.

These systems analyze play-by-play data and betting patterns. Powerful computers process thousands of wagers at once.

This infrastructure allows for dynamic in-play markets. Fans can now react to every moment as it happens.

Risks and Challenges in Live Betting

While in-play markets offer excitement, they also introduce significant risks that demand careful management. The fast-paced environment can test your discipline and lead to quick losses if you’re not prepared.

Impulse Betting and Potential Addiction

The constant flow of new wagers can trigger compulsive behavior. Adrenaline from the game often overrides rational thinking.

This leads to hasty decisions without proper analysis. The immediate feedback loop creates patterns similar to other rapid-result gambling.

Make sure you set strict limits on your session. Recognize warning signs like chasing losses or increasing stake sizes.

Managing Rapidly Changing Odds

Odds can shift in seconds after a goal or injury. You have little time to secure a favorable price before it’s gone.

This pressure forces poorly planned bets. Many participants perform worse during in-play action due to this lack of discipline.

Use the table below to understand key challenges and strategies.

Risk Factor Challenge Mitigation Strategy
Impulse Decisions Constant new opportunities trigger quick wagers. Pause for 30 seconds before placing any bet.
Time Pressure Odds change rapidly, forcing hasty choices. Pre-decide on a few specific market types.
Odds Volatility Sudden game events alter prices instantly. Use limit orders if your platform allows them.
Bankroll Management Easy to lose track of total wagered amount. Set a strict session budget and stick to it.

Taking regular breaks helps maintain clear judgment. Avoid emotional decisions right after a big play.

Navigating Live Betting Options: Markets and Bets

The real-time nature of in-play wagering opens up a vast menu of specialized markets beyond the final score. You can find dozens of unique opportunities that focus on specific moments within a contest.

Diverse In-Play Betting Markets Explained

Each sport features its own set of dynamic markets. Football offers wagers on the next team to score or the result of a specific drive.

Basketball presents options like which team will commit the next foul. Soccer and tennis have equally granular markets based on their flow.

Examples of Popular Bets and Their Mechanics

Understanding how these wagers work is key. A “Next Team to Score” bet is settled as soon as the next goal or point is recorded.

An “Over/Under Total Points” market asks if the combined score will finish above or below a moving line. These are core components of in-play wagering.

Sport Market Example What You’re Wagering On
Football Next Drive Result Outcome of the next offensive possession (TD, FG, Turnover)
Basketball First to 25 Points Which team reaches the specified point total first
Soccer Next Corner Kick Which side will be awarded the next corner
Tennis Next Set Winner Which player will win the upcoming set

This table shows just a sample of the available markets. The variety keeps the experience engaging for every major sport.

Comparing Live Betting to Pre-Match Betting

The core distinction in sports gambling lies in when you place your wager: before the event or during it. Traditional pre-match action requires you to commit hours or days ahead. In-play markets, however, let you engage continuously from the first whistle to the last.

Differences in Flexibility and Betting Windows

Pre-match gambling locks you into a prediction. Once the game starts, your bet is final. The in-play way offers constant adjustment. You can place new bets during commercial breaks or even between pitches.

This creates a dramatic time pressure difference. Pre-match analysis can be slow and methodical. Real-time decisions must be quick, relying on observed momentum and flow.

Market variety also expands massively. Pre-match options might cover 20-50 outcomes. In-play betting can generate hundreds of unique markets as each quarter or set unfolds.

The strategic mindset shifts completely. Pre-match rewards deep research. In-play betting favors quick thinking and the ability to read the action as it happens.

Odds present different value propositions. Early odds before a game might hold hidden value. Moving odds during play can offer chances when the public overreacts to a single play.

Live Betting Strategies: Tips and Best Practices

Mastering real-time wagering requires a blend of sharp timing and smart data analysis. This section provides actionable advice to help you navigate dynamic markets and improve your outcomes.

Timing Your Bets with Live Odds Updates

Identify optimal moments when odds shift dramatically. In football, place wagers after a touchdown when lines readjust.

During a basketball timeout, momentum may change. This creates a valuable window for a strategic move.

For tennis, watch the breaks between games. Player fatigue or confidence swings often become apparent then.

Recognize when the public overreacts to a single play. A strong team falling behind early can create temporary value in the odds.

Leveraging In-Play Data to Optimize Payouts

Use real-time statistics to make informed decisions. Monitor possession percentages, shot attempts, and yards gained.

In football, track drive efficiency and red zone performance. For basketball, watch shooting percentages and foul trouble.

Tennis data like first-serve percentage and unforced errors reveals player stamina. This data helps you take advantage of the game flow.
